Next up, we head to the NRM to take a look at one of the most famous steam locomotives of the national collection... Mallard. Curator Bob Gwynne tells the story of Mallard, an innovative locomotive whose greatest claim to fame is the 126mph top speed it achieved on an infamous run down Stoke Bank on the East Coast Main Line.
